World Class TrainingIn today's changing workplace, many new supervisors are unsure of their roles and responsibilities. They have little experience dealing with the challenges of managing work through others. They haven't had the opportunity to develop those critical skills of planning work, leading their group, and communicating with their employees, their colleagues and their manager. Learning these skills can have a tremendous impact on an organisation's productivity. Learning Outcomes
Who Will BenefitTeam Leaders, Supervisors and Managers responsible for leading, controlling and motivating teams. The course is particularly suitable for newly appointed Leaders, Supervisors faced with significant change, or any longer serving front-line managers who have not had the benefit of any formal training and may need to update and refresh their skills.
